What was one constant or holdover from the roman empire that extended through the middle ages?

One thing that remained through the Middle Ages, all over the areas where the Roman Empire had been, was the Church.

Was nostradamus alive in the Middle Ages?

Nostrodamus lived from 1503-1566. This would fall well after the "end" of the Middle Ages and would, in European history, have lived through the late Renaissance period and into the Religious Wars.
